| Computer Science 209a/b Applied Logic for Computer Science |
|
Propositional and predicate logic; representing static and dynamic properties of real-world systems; logic as a tool for representation, reasoning and calculation; logic and programming. |
| Prerequisite: Computer Science 027a/b, or permission of the Department. |
| 4 lecture hours, half course. |
